i have an idea for a silent case
if the cpu and north/south bridge chips were mounted on the opposite side of the MB a large heatsink the size of the MB could be attached held in place by spacers and the mb mounts.
next the psu would be the fanless type and the video cards could be cooled with heat pipes that attached to the large heatsink
all you would hear is the hdd and opticals spinning up
and possibly a large fan, which is quieter, blowing through a tunnel past the hdd, the memory and video cards ensuring everything stays cool. the large heatsink by the way would protrude outside the case.
